Eric McCredie: A Brief Overview

Born on September 22, 1945, in Patrick, Glasgow, Scotland, Eric McCredie made a profound impact on the music scene as a masterful pop bassist. He is best well-known for his work with the band Middle Of The Road, a group that shot to fame in the early 1970s with their catchy melodies and unforgettable hits.

Eric's journey into music began in Glasgow, where he honed his skills and developed a passion for pop music. He gained recognition as the bassist for Middle Of The Road, the band that delivered chart-toppers like 'Chirpy, Chirpy, Cheep Cheep'. This infectious song, released in 1971, became a global sensation and remains a nostalgic favorite.

Eric McCredie and Middle Of The Road

Middle Of The Road was formed in the late 1960s, and with Eric's talent on bass, they crafted a sound that fused pop and folk influences. Their major hit, 'Chirpy, Chirpy, Cheep Cheep', dominated the charts, selling millions of copies worldwide. Eric's rhythms contributed significantly to the band’s distinctive sound.
